Prime Minister Edi Rama held a meeting with young people employed through employment promotion programs, where he presented the latest figures on the results of these schemes. He said that, according to the OECD report, Albania ranks first in the region for employment services, which according to him testifies to the progress made in structuring employment policies.
"I want to start with a fact that is not well-known, Albania, according to the OECD, which is a very serious source of data and observations on countries, is the country that ranks first in the region for employment services. This is something very positive, because it clearly speaks to the fact that the work we have done these years has given us an encouraging result," he said.
The Prime Minister emphasized that in the last five years alone, 42,000 young people have been employed through job centers and dedicated programs, while 2,200 young people currently benefit from the Youth Guarantee. He announced that the government's objective is for 60,000 young people to benefit from these programs within the government's mandate.
"There are seven programs that operate today to promote employment, covering all categories ranging from professional practices to on-the-job training, from self-employment, to social integration. And, another fact that is good to know. Young people, who are quite normal are skeptical, even indifferent to these words, in just the last 5 years, 42 thousand boys and girls have been employed through our employment offices and through these services. And, of this figure, 7 thousand and 500 are individuals who have benefited from the programs and are in work today," he said.
Rama also spoke about the 2026 budget, which foresees a 60 percent increase in the fund dedicated to youth, with a special focus on promoting self-employment and startups, 37 percent of which are run by girls.
"37% of these startups are made up of or run by girls and it is 2 times the EU average and proves my theory that women will save Albania. I am convinced of this. There is also another program, which is the self-employment program. We want to continue to increase the number of young people who want to be self-employed, we talk about all kinds of things. Young people who want to open a small business, we want to put them in the focus of this support. The budget for next year is considerable and what is important is that it is the largest budget ever to promote employment for young people. We have increased the amount dedicated to young people by 60%", said the Prime Minister./ CNA
